UFC 242 went down today (Sat. September 7, 2019) from The Arena on Yas Island and we have you covered with the results. The world’s leading mixed martial arts (MMA) promotion compiled an excellent card for fight fans to enjoy.
It was headlined by a meeting between UFC lightweight champion Khabib Nurmagomedov and Dustin Poirier.
Khabib Nurmagomedov vs. Dustin Poirier
Nurmagomedov got a takedown after a slow start midway through the first round and got his back where he teased neck cranks. Complete domination by Nurmagomedov in the first round with holding him. In the second round, Poirier stunned him and went after him while Nurmagomedov was trying to recover. Nurmagomedov took him down with a double leg to get the fight back where he wanted. Nurmagomedov took him down yet again in the third round but Poirier teased a guillotine choke but Nurmagomedov got out of it. Nurmagomedov got the rear-naked choke and got the win.
Edson Barboza vs. Paul Felder
Felder was cut open with a headbutt early in the first round but the doctor gave the okay to continue. They clashed heads which opened him up. Things changed in the second round as Barboza scored a takedown and got full guard where they traded strikes. Felder went for an armbar in midway through the round but Barboza was able to escape. Barboza was cut from an elbow from Felder from the bottom. Felder walked away with the decision win.
Islam Makhachev vs. Davi Ramos
These guys were looking to strike it out. Makhachev clipped him in the first round but Ramos was able to recover. Ramos landed a good right hand late. Ramos was looking for a takedown in round two but wasn’t able to get it. Makhachev stuffs it and they’re in the clinch. Ramos still not leading, and still slowly getting out-worked. Ramos pushes forward again and gets dropped hard by a knee. Makhachev chases him to the ground with a flurry of punches. The fight went the distance and Makhachev got the win.
Curtis Blaydes vs. Shamil Abdurakhimov
This one was all Blaydes, who dominated this fight with his wrestling and ground control with a touch of big bombs. In the second round, Blaydes started to rain down big shots until the referee stepped in for the stoppage.
Mairbek Taisumov vs. Carlos Diego Ferreira
It was mostly striking through the rounds as Ferreira was constantly walking down his opponent. They had some nice striking exchanges. Taisumov with a nice leg kick that knocked Ferreria off balance. The big moment in round one saw Taisumov caught him with a strike just behind the ear that led to Ferriera going backwards. They slugged it out to the bell that saw Ferreira pick up the decision win.

Quick UFC 242 Results
Main Card (2 PM ET/PPV)
- UFC lightweight title bout: Khabib Nurmagomedov def. Dustin Poirier by submission (rear-naked choke) at 2:06 of Round 3
- Lightweight bout: Paul Felder def. Edson Barboza by split decision (27-30, 29-28, 30-27)
- Lightweight bout: Islam Makhachev def. Davi Ramos by unanimous decision (29-27, 30-26, 30-26)
- Heavyweight bout: Curtis Blaydes def. Shamil Abdurakhimov via technical knockout (Round 2, 2:22)
- Lightweight bout: Diego Ferreira def. Mairbek Taisumov by unanimous decision (29-28, 29-27, 29-27)
Preliminary Card (12 PM ET/FX)
- Women’s flyweight bout: Joanne Calderwood def. Andrea Lee by split decision (28-29, 30-27, 29-28)
- Featherweight bout: Zubaira Tukhugov vs. Lerone Murphy ends in a split draw (29-28, 28-29, 28-28)
- Women’s featherweight bout: Sarah Moras def. Liana Jojua by TKO (strikes) at 2:26 of Round 3
- Lightweight bout: Ottman Azaitar def. Teemu Packalen by knockout (punch) at 3:33 of Round 1
Preliminary Card (10:15 AM ET/ESPN+)
- Welterweight bout: Belal Muhammad def. Takashi Sato by submission (rear-naked choke) at 1:55 of Round 3
- Welterweight bout: Muslim Salikhov def. Nordine Taleb by TKO (punch) at 4:26 of Round 1
- Middleweight bout: Omari Akhmedov def. Zak Cummings by unanimous decision (30-27, 30-27, 29-28)
- Lightweight bout: Don Madge def. Fares Ziam by unanimous decision (30-27, 30-27, 29-28)
